Hurtigruten has grounded in the Sognefjord – NRK Vestland

--

A fast route ship has run aground in Steinsundet.

The main rescue center (HRS) was notified of the grounding at 09.05 on Friday morning.

All emergency services have been notified and are on their way to the scene. So is a tugboat.

– At the moment we don’t know much more than that the ship has run aground, says communications adviser Anja Bakken in HRS.

There will be 70 people on board, the operations manager in the West police district tells NRK.

TV 2 first reported the incident.

The NAIS service shows that the ship sailed in a circle outside Ålesund last night, and that it lost speed at 09:01 today.

– Serious

According to HRS, no one should be injured, but work is still being done to get an overview of the situation.

There is currently no indication that anyone is injured or that the ship is taking on water.

– But it is clear that it is serious when a large ship runs aground, says Bakken.

The boat has recently been at Myklebust shipyard for conversion to battery operation.

The ship Richard With is named after Hurtigruten’s founder. The ship was built in 1993 and has a capacity of 590 passengers.

In 2009, the ship had a longer stay at the workshop after a grounding in Trondheim.

According to the tracking service MarineTraffic the ship was on its way from Hareid on Sunnmøre to Bergen.
